What is an Apex Cheat?

An apex cheat refers to any unauthorized software, script, or exploit used to gain an unfair advantage in Apex Legends. Common forms include aimbots, which automatically lock onto opponents for perfect accuracy; wallhacks, allowing players to see through walls; and speed hacks, which increase movement speed beyond normal limits. These apex cheat tools undermine the skill-based nature of the game, frustrating legitimate players and skewing competitive integrity.

The Impact of Apex Cheat on the Community

The presence of apex cheat practices has far-reaching consequences. For casual players, encountering cheaters can diminish enjoyment, leading to distrust in matchmaking systems. In competitive settings, apex cheat incidents can tarnish tournament legitimacy, as seen in past esports events where players were banned mid-match for using hacks. Data from gaming forums and posts on X suggest that apex cheat complaints surged in 2023, with players reporting frequent encounters with aimbots in ranked matches.

Moreover, the apex cheat economy—where cheats are sold for profit—has created a black market, further complicating enforcement efforts. Developers like Respawn Entertainment face pressure to maintain a fair environment while balancing resources for game updates and anti-cheat measures.

Combating Apex Cheat: Developer and Community Efforts

Respawn Entertainment and EA have implemented several strategies to tackle apex cheat issues. The game employs Easy Anti-Cheat, a system designed to detect and ban cheaters automatically. Regular ban waves, often targeting thousands of accounts, are announced to deter apex cheat usage. For instance, in 2024, Respawn reported banning over 100,000 accounts in a single month for using apex cheat software.

The community also plays a role. Players report suspicious behavior through in-game tools, and content creators on platforms like X highlight apex cheat incidents to raise awareness. However, some argue that anti-cheat systems lag behind cheat developers, who continuously update apex cheat tools to evade detection.
